Trains from Nuremberg to Feldkirch run on average 14 times per day, taking around 4h 1m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at $36 (€29) but you can travel from only $24 (€20) by bus.
The earliest train runs at 01:00, the last at 23:24. The fastest train covers the 167 miles (269 km) distance in 4h 41m.
